Marking the 50th anniversary of Kennedy’s visit to Ireland.

PROGRAMME 1:

THE COLUMBAN FATHERS PRESENT: PRESIDENT KENNEDY IN IRELAND

The only professional colour film of the visit.

FILM INFO: 25 minutes, 1963, Colour

PROGRAMME 2:

TAOISEACH LEMASS VISITS THE U.S.A. 1963

State visit to U.S. made just weeks before Kennedy’s assassination in Dallas.

FILM INFO: 10 minutes, 1963, Colour

JOHN F. KENNEDY, THE MAN AND THE PRESIDENT 1917 – 1963

The main events in the public life and death of Kennedy.

FILM INFO: 10 minutes, 1963, Black and White
